Focus Rally: America
Mark Episode As Watched

SEASON 1 • EPISODE 18

Focus Rally: America

"A Wing With a View"

Date Aired: Feb 22, 2011

Avg Rating (0)
Your Rating
The Focus Rally Teams arrive in Peoria, Arizona, for their next challenge.
Buy or StreamAmazonAmazon UK